Sludge dewatering – mobile or stationary

  • Sludge dewatering is primarily concerned with treating industrial sludge using the solid-liquid separation process. Products such as lyes, acids or oils are filtered and oil-water-solid mixtures are decanted. In many cases, mobile sludge dewatering is an essential component of an complex overall concept.

    We encounter sludge in various areas of industrial life. The best known is clarification sludge, which accrues while cleaning wastewater. But sludge – or suspensions – also accrue at many other points, e.g.:

    • Through natural precipitation
    • In iron and steel production
    • In the mineral oil industry
    • While cleaning plants with water
    • In tunnel construction
    • In water management

Solids-fluids separation

  • FILTRATEC treats and filters many kinds of sludge. The goal of sludge dewatering is to achieve separation between the solids and liquids with the aim of volume reduction. In mechanical sludge de-watering, the use of filter presses and decanters has proved itself. FILTRATEC uses various pieces of equipment to accomplish this.

Recovery and transportation of the sludge

  • We deploy the most varying types of conveyor machinery – each suited to the area of operation

    The basics steps are the recovery and transportation of the sludge. FILTRATEC operates float-ing suction excavators. They can extract sludge below the standing water phase. During this, the sediments are dissolved with cutting tools and are routed to the preparation plant through floating delivery lines.

      • Recovering the sludge – even under water
      • Transfer within the treatment plant
      • Loading the solids/filter cake
      • Discharging the fluid phases

Pretreatment of the sludge

  • Sedimentation tanks for waste-water treatment

  • When necessary, the sludge is first put through a pre-treatment, for example for

    • separation of rough and foreign bodies,
    • prethickening,
    • separation of oil content,
    • heating up.

    Depending on the requirements, the sludge/suspensions can also be chemically-physically pre-treated. That is done for

    • decontamination, for instance of cyanide, chrome-VI, hydrogen sulphide,
    • neutralisation of acids and lyes,
    • flocking and precipitation, for instance of heavy metals.

Subsequent treatment and loading/discharging the sludge

  • The processing phases can continue to be used so they have to be suitably subsequently treated:

    • Neutralisation of filter water
    • Exhaust purification through activated carbon filter

    The process with the solids or the filter cake usually proceeds as described below:

    • Direct loading into trucks or containers
    • Loading into containers with forklifts or conveyor belts
    • Packing in Big-Bags
  • The resulting liquid phases (oil and water) can then be pumped away as required.

Process engineering laboratory investigations

  • Before deployment, the treatment instructions are worked out in the FILTRATEC process engineering lab. These preparatory measures guarantee a high degree of separation, maximum solids content in the filter cake, and solid-free filtrate:

      • Preparation of treatment instructions
      • Determination of the filter and flocculation additives required
      • Filtration and separation trials
      • Preparation of sieve analyses
      • Determination and documentation of all physical parameters relating to the treatment process
      • Centrifuge trials
      • Project-specific monitoring analyses

    Five parts sludge become four parts water which can be passed into the environment, and one part solids
